The NIU Higher Education & Student Affairs Program in the College of Education offers professional preparation for students at the master’s and doctoral levels. M.S.Ed. Program: If you are passionate about helping college students learn and develop, our M.S.Ed. in Higher Education and Student Affairs will equip you to succeed and lead. Our program grounds you in the theory and methodology of student development. Our program prepares you for a variety of leadership and administrative positions in student affairs and higher education. The program is 36 semester hours; internships generally require 120 hours of field experience. Ed.D. in Higher Education: Our Executive Weekend Ed.D. in Higher Education will prepare you to advance in leadership roles at various types of postsecondary institutions. The program provides you with analytical, theoretical and foundational groundings to address contemporary issues facing higher education educators, administrators and institutions. Topics related to diversity, social justice and inclusion are thread throughout the curriculum. You will have the opportunity to engage with a dynamic community of experts in order to enhance your leadership skills. You can choose an emphasis in Higher Education Administration or College Teaching.Ed.D. in Community College Leadership: Our Community College Leadership Ed.D. program is designed to prepare higher education professionals to advance in a variety of administrative positions within the community college environment. Our online program (with face-to-face instruction for one week over the summer) emphasizes applied practice and action-based research, giving midcareer professionals the edge to move ahead. The Ed.D. in Higher Education specializing in Community College Leadership consists of 54 credit hours beyond the master's degree and is designed to be completed within three years.
